What is Bitcoin Blockchain?

At its core, the Bitcoin blockchain is a digital ledger that records all Bitcoin transactions. Unlike traditional banking ledgers controlled by banks or governments, the Bitcoin blockchain is decentralized, meaning no single entity has control.

Key Features:

  • Decentralization: The ledger is stored across thousands of computers worldwide (nodes).
  • Visibility: Each transaction is stored publicly and can be checked by anyone
  • Security: Cryptography ensures transactions are secure and tamper-proof.
  • Immutable records: Once a transaction is added to the blockchain, it cannot be reversed or changed.

Think of it as a chain of blocks (hence “blockchain”), where each block contains a set of transactions. Once a block is filled, it is linked to the previous block using a cryptographic code called a hash, forming an unbreakable chain. This makes fraud nearly impossible.

Why is the Bitcoin Blockchain Important?

Understanding the importance of the Bitcoin blockchain is crucial for anyone diving into crypto.

1. Removes Intermediaries

Traditional money transfers require banks or payment processors. Blockchain removes the middleman, enabling peer-to-peer transactions, reducing costs and speeding up transfers globally.

2. Enhances Security

Blockchain uses advanced cryptography and consensus algorithms (proof-of-work) to secure transactions. Unlike centralized systems, hacking or tampering with a blockchain is extremely difficult.

3. Promotes Transparency

Every Bitcoin transaction is recorded on a public ledger. Anyone can verify transactions in real-time without compromising privacy, creating a transparent financial system.

4. Decentralized Finance (DeFi) Foundation

The Bitcoin blockchain set the stage for DeFi applications. It proves that financial operations can exist outside traditional banks, inspiring innovations in lending, trading, and digital assets.

How the Bitcoin Blockchain Works: Step by Step

Understanding the blockchain requires breaking down its processes. Here’s a simple step-by-step explanation:

Step 1: Transaction Initiation

A Bitcoin user initiates a transaction, specifying the recipient’s wallet address and the amount. A digital signature from the sender’s private key ensures the transaction is legitimate

Step 2: Transaction Verification

Transactions are broadcasted to the network of nodes. Nodes verify the transaction using the public key and ensure the sender has sufficient funds. Invalid transactions are rejected.

Step 3: Grouping Transactions into a Block

Verified transactions are grouped into a block. A block can contain hundreds of transactions depending on network activity.

Step 4: Proof-of-Work and Mining

Miners compete to solve complex mathematical problems (proof-of-work). The first miner to solve the problem adds the block to the blockchain and receives a Bitcoin reward.

Step 5: Adding to the Blockchain

Once a block is verified and added, it becomes a permanent part of the blockchain. The block contains a unique hash linking it to the previous block, ensuring continuity and security.

Step 6: Transaction Completion

After the block is added, the transaction is complete. The recipient can see the transaction in their wallet, fully verified and immutable.

Risks and Challenges

While blockchain is revolutionary, there are risks associated with Bitcoin:

  • Price Volatility: Bitcoin is highly volatile; market swings can result in large gains or losses.
  • Energy Consumption: Proof-of-work mining consumes significant energy, raising environmental concerns.
  • Regulatory Uncertainty: Governments may impose restrictions or regulations affecting Bitcoin usage.
  • Cybersecurity Threats: Although the blockchain is secure, individual wallets and exchanges can be hacked.
  • Limited Transaction Speed: Bitcoin can process 7 transactions per second, slower than traditional payment networks.

Understanding these risks is crucial for informed decision-making in crypto investments.

Common Bitcoin Blockchain Myths

Myth 1: Bitcoin is completely anonymous

Truth: Bitcoin is pseudonymous, meaning addresses are visible on the blockchain. While identities are not directly exposed, sophisticated analysis can link addresses to individuals.

Myth 2: Blockchain is only for Bitcoin

Truth: Blockchain technology powers thousands of cryptocurrencies and applications, including smart contracts and supply chain management.

Myth 3: Transactions are instant

Truth: Bitcoin transactions require block confirmation. Depending on network congestion, it may take several minutes to an hour.

Myth 4: Bitcoin is not secure

Truth: Bitcoin itself is highly secure. Most hacks occur on exchanges or wallets, not the blockchain.

How to Use Bitcoin Safely

  • Wallet Security: Choose secure hardware wallets or reputable software wallets
  • Enable Two-Factor Authentication: Adds an extra layer of security for exchanges.
  • Verify Transaction Addresses: Mistyped addresses can result in lost funds.
  • Keep Private Keys Safe: Losing private keys means losing access to your Bitcoin permanently.
  • Start Small: Begin with small amounts until comfortable with transactions.

FAQ Section

Q1: What is a blockchain in crypto?
A: A blockchain is a decentralized digital ledger that records transactions in blocks, linked securely using cryptography.

Q2: How does Bitcoin mining work?
A: Miners solve complex mathematical problems to verify transactions and add blocks to the blockchain, earning Bitcoin as a reward.

Q3: Are Bitcoin transactions really secure?
A: Yes, the blockchain uses cryptography and decentralized consensus, making transactions highly secure and tamper-proof.

Q4: Can I lose my Bitcoin?
A: Yes, if you lose your private key or wallet access, your Bitcoin can be permanently inaccessible.

Q5: Is Bitcoin blockchain anonymous?
A: Bitcoin is pseudonymous; transactions are visible but identities are not directly revealed.

Q6: How long does a Bitcoin transaction take?
A: Usually 10–60 minutes, depending on network congestion and miner fees.
